## Scanner Hookup — Quick Steps

New contractors: the Quickbeam barcode bridge runs as a sidecar next to the warehouse API. Pull the `qb-bridge` image, mount `/etc/quickbeam/env`, and restart with `svctl restart qb-bridge`. Scans fail silently if the env is incomplete, so check logs under `bridge.scan` first. The bridge authenticates to the Lattermill inventory service on boot; its env file must define the service credential directly below this line.

vault entry, bagaf-fahog: ARCHIVE_KEY3=71e

### Klaxonette dedup engine — excerpt

Alerts are fingerprinted via normalized labels; fingerprints never include payload bodies, so no secrets enter the dedup store. Suppression windows are bounded to prevent an attacker flooding crafted alerts to mask a real incident: window growth is capped and decays on quiet periods. All counters live in an in-memory ring with TTL eviction; nothing persists past restart. Review focus: cap values versus masking risk. Effective constants at deploy are listed here.

tuning table, yajog-yahof:
BUDGETS = {
    "lamvan": 303,
    "wenox": 460,
    "fenvan": 525,
}

Night shift handover — Caldewick basement archive. Shelving crew finished at 21:00; aisles three and four still taped off, keep people out. Dehumidifier running, empty the tray at 02:00. Retrieval requests go in the tray, not the log. Door must stay locked between visits. If you need to enter, the keypad takes the code below.

door code, kawip-bagap: bdg-HQEWH-4

Runbook: LocaleHarvest extraction script (Fennmore team). The script walks the UI repo, extracts translation strings, and pushes them to the Wrenfield translation hub nightly. If extraction fails, check for malformed interpolation tokens first — they account for most breakage. Reruns are safe and idempotent. The push step authenticates to the hub, and its upload credential belongs on the next line of the env file.

env line for yageg-kahip: COURIER_KEY20=bd8cf971b90c4183e503